/IAM/UI100 No changes were saved
typically occurs in the context of the Identity Access Management (IAM) module when a user attempts to save changes to a configuration or data entry, but the system fails to save those changes. This can happen for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for finding a solution.Possible Causes:
Validation Errors: The data entered may not meet the required validation criteria. This could be due to missing mandatory fields, incorrect data formats, or values that do not comply with business rules.
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to make changes to the specific data or configuration. This can happen if the user’s role does not include the required authorizations.
Technical Issues: There may be underlying technical issues, such as database connectivity problems, system performance issues, or bugs in the application.
Session Timeout: If the user session has timed out, any unsaved changes will not be processed, leading to this error message.
Locking Issues: The data being modified might be locked by another user or process, preventing changes from being saved.
Solutions:
Check Validation Rules: Review the data entered for any validation errors. Ensure that all mandatory fields are filled out correctly and that the data adheres to the required formats.
Review Authorizations: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the action. This may involve checking the user’s role assignments and permissions in the IAM system.
Technical Troubleshooting:
- Check the system logs for any error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.
- Ensure that the database and application servers are functioning correctly and that there are no connectivity issues.
Session Management: If the session has timed out, log out and log back in to the system. Ensure that you save your work frequently to avoid losing changes.
Check for Locks: If the data is locked, you may need to wait until the lock is released or contact the user who has locked the data to resolve the issue.
